In a #large bowl{}, whisk together the @peanut butter{1/4%cup (64 g)}, @tamari{1.5%Tbsp (22 g)}, @lime juice{1.5%Tbsp (22 g)}, @rice vinegar{1%Tbsp (15 g)}, @maple syrup{2%tsp (14 g)}, minced @garlic{2%large cloves}, minced @ginger{1%Tbsp (15 g)}, and @warm water{2%Tbsp (30 g)} until smooth. Transfer the cut tofu to the bowl and toss to coat. Place the tofu in an #airtight container{} and pour the remaining sauce onto the tofu. Marinate for at least ~{15%minutes}. Or refrigerate for up to 4 days, or freeze for up to 3 months. Thaw in the refrigerator before using. Bake, grill, air fry, or pan fry the tofu. Heat the sauce in a #medium skillet{} over medium-low heat. Thin with extra water or milk if needed.
